简述虚拟时钟的表盘里表盘的绘制步骤

毕业设计 题 目 学生姓名 学号 所在院(系) 物理与电信工程学院 专业班级 电子信息科学与技术102 指导教师 完成地点 实验楼1104教室 2015年 1 设计任务及方案论证 1 1.1设计任务与要求 1 1.2 总体方案论证與设计 1 2系统硬件设置 1 2.1 STC89C51单片机简介 1 2.2显示模块设计 3 2.2.1 PG12864LCD的特性介绍 如今二十一电子钟、机械式手表等钟表已经普遍存在于市场,并且钟表已经成为人們生活中不可缺少的一部分在生活中到处都能看到其身影。当穿行于马路上时总会看到几乎每个人手腕上戴着一块手表当大人家里做愙时总能看到大厅里面挂着个钟表。当打开手机时屏幕上依旧是钟表的画面时间伴随着我们钟表也成为我们生活中必不可少的一大部分。当今市场有好多电子钟,但大多数是纯数字式的,指针式的电子钟比较新颖,而且具有真实表盘式时钟的表盘的效果 用PG12864LCD设计的模拟电子钟采鼡PG12864LCD液晶屏,用来模拟表盘与时分秒指针指示当前时钟的表盘,此模拟指针式电子钟实现的功能为:在PG12864显示屏上显示圆形表盘与时分秒三个指针表示当前时刻;三个按键,K1键用来选择工作模式;K2键用来选择调整时分秒;K3键用来调节大小 1 设计任务及方案论证 1.1设计任务与要求 利用单爿机等器件做一个简易的模拟指针式时钟的表盘,硬件设计以单片机为主要包括显示、复位、时钟的表盘采用PG12864液晶屏作为显示单元,液晶屏表盘、时、分、秒并且设置按钮可以调节时间软件设计主要是通过单片机编程软件Keil 设计模拟仿真是利用仿真软件Proteus对所设计的硬件电路和程序进行试。 2系统硬件设置 2.1 STC89C51单片机简介 在设计中可用STC89C5代替AT89C51此芯片具有速度 更高,功能更全寿命更长,价格更低等优点;我们采用双 列矗插40引脚的 STC89C51它可以实现ISP在线编程功能, 然而AT89C51则不可以将AT89C51的程序通过软件直接下载 到STC89C51中后,就可以代替AT单片

}

values文件夹下新建一个xml文件,定义参数

/**根据实际情况我们需要判断下时分秒的数字是不是小于10如果是前面补一位0*/

3.4绘制刻度线(让画布旋转)

3.5 画表盘上的数字

3.6 发送一条空消息,让时间數字,走起来

3.7画时针分针秒针(必须要先保存之前的画的,不然会一起动)


}3.8 最后在中心画点把指针覆盖

直接的粘的代码,看的不是很清楚,慢慢看咯

}

我要回帖

更多关于 时钟的表盘 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信